Nutella Pekan Nut Croissants

Ingredients

  • 1 packet of flaky pastry (from the chiller cabinet)

  • 1/2 cup pecans, roughly chopped

  • 1/4 teaspoon cinnamon

  • 2 tablespoons butter, melted

  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

  • Nutella

Instructions

  • Start by preheating your oven to 180 degrees Celsius (356 degrees Fahrenheit) using the convection setting. A properly preheated oven is crucial for successful baking.

  • Place butter in a pot and let it brown on low heat until it turns into nutty butter. This will give your croissants an extra flavor kick.

  • Roughly chop the pecans and roast them in the brown butter. Add a pinch of salt, and you've got the perfect filling for your croissants.

  • Roll out the puff pastry. For this recipe, I used a whole wheat dough from the supermarket. Here's a tip: opt for a round pre-made dough as it's easier to handle.

  • Cut the round dough into small pieces, similar to a pizza.

  • First, spread a generous layer of Nutella on each piece of dough. Then sprinkle the roasted pecans on top.

  • Now, roll each piece of dough from the outside in. And voila, you've got beautiful croissants.

  • Bake everything in the oven according to the package instructions. In my case, it took about 18 minutes. After that, you can savor your homemade Pecan Nutella Croissants!
